Pinwheel Sandwiches

Pinwheel sandwiches are rolled tortillas or flatbreads filled with meats, cheeses, spreads, and veggies, then sliced into bite-sized spirals. They’re colorful, customizable, and perfect for parties, lunchboxes, or on-the-go snacks.

Ingredients

  • 4 large flour tortillas or flatbreads
  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 8 slices deli meat (turkey, chicken, or roast beef)
  • 4 slices cheese (cheddar, Swiss, provolone, or preferred)
  • 1 cup lettuce or spinach
  • 1/2 cup sliced vegetables (e.g., cucumbers, bell peppers, tomatoes)
  • 2 tablespoons mustard or mayonnaise (optional)
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Lay a tortilla or flatbread on a clean surface.
  2. Spread a thin, even layer of softened cream cheese over the entire surface.
  3. Add a layer of deli meat and a slice of cheese on top.
  4. Top with lettuce or spinach and your choice of sliced vegetables.
  5. Optional: Add a small amount of mustard or mayonnaise for extra flavor.
  6. Season lightly with salt and pepper.
  7. Roll the tortilla tightly from one end to the other, keeping the filling compact.
  8. Wrap the rolled tortilla in pl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to firm up.
  9. Remove from fridge, unwrap, and slice into 1-inch pinwheel pieces.
  10. Arrange on a platter and serve cold or at room temperature.

Notes

Use large, soft flour tortillas to prevent cracking when rolling.Chilling before slicing helps maintain shape and makes slicing easier.Layer parchment paper between stacked pinwheels for easy transport.Not ideal for freezing due to moisture from vegetables and texture changes in the tortilla.Customize fillings based on dietary needs or flavor preferences.
